A Stable Lapse Rate is defined as less than how many degrees?

Explanation:
Stability in the atmosphere is about how quickly temperature falls with height. A stable lapse rate means that as you go up, the temperature drops only a little. In this context, when the lapse rate is less than 5.5 degrees per 1,000 feet, the environment is stable: a parcel of air that rises will cool and become cooler (and denser) than its surroundings, so it tends to sink back down rather than continue rising. That makes vertical motion difficult and the atmosphere stable. If the lapse rate were greater than 5.5, rising air would stay warmer than its surroundings and continue to rise, indicating instability.
